Currently, one of the most important threats dealing with England’s restoration from lockdown is Covid-19 variants.

These variants may have an effect of the continued vaccination roll-out, which to this point has been a serious pillar of England’s restoration.

Where European countries are in the midst of a 3rd wave, England is getting ready to reopen pub gardens, non-essential retailers, hairdressers and gyms from April 12.

It signifies that the most important fear for the Government is the unfold of a brand new vaccine-resistant variant of Covid-19, which may enter the nation from abroad.

Because of this, the Government has revealed a ‘red-list’ of countries.

These locations are in danger of bringing in new variants as a result of their respectively excessive an infection charges.

Only British and Irish residents might enter from these countries, and they need to quarantine for a full 10 days in a resort earlier than coming into England.

Any non-British or non-Irish residents can be turned away on the border in the event that they arrive in the nation having began their journey in a ‘red-list’ nation, or travelled by means of one on their journey to the UK.

New countries are being added to the list on a regular basis.

The newest countries to be added had been Bangladesh, the Philippines, Kenya and Pakistan, which had been all added yesterday (Friday, April 2).

Here is the complete list of ‘red-list’ countries where travel bans are in impact:

  • Angola
  • Argentina
  • Bangladesh (can be added to the list 4am Friday 9 April)
  • Bolivia
  • Botswana
  • Brazil
  • Burundi
  • Cape Verde
  • Chile
  • Colombia
  • Democratic Republic of the Congo
  • Ecuador
  • Eswatini
  • Ethiopia
  • French Guiana
  • Guyana
  • Kenya (can be added to the list 4am Friday 9 April)
  • Lesotho
  • Malawi
  • Mozambique
  • Namibia
  • Oman
  • Pakistan (can be added to the list 4am Friday 9 April)
  • Panama
  • Paraguay
  • Peru
  • Philippines (can be added to the list 4am Friday 9 April)
  • Qatar
  • Rwanda
  • Seychelles
  • Somalia
  • South Africa
  • Suriname
  • Tanzania
  • United Arab Emirates (UAE)
  • Uruguay
  • Venezuela
  • Zambia
  • Zimbabwe
